create access_profile
tcp Specifies that the switch will examine each frames
Transport Control Protocol (TCP) field.
src_port_mask <hex 0x0-0xffff> Specifies a TCP port
mask for the source port.
dst_port_mask <hex 0x0-0xffff> Specifies a TCP port
mask for the destination port.
flag_mask [ all | {urg | ack | psh | rst | syn | fin}] – Enter the
appropriate flag_mask parameter. All incoming packets have
TCP port numbers contained in them as the forwarding
criterion. These numbers have flag bits associated with them
which are parts of a packet that determine what to do with
the packet. The user may deny packets by denying certain
flag bits within the packets. The user may choose between
all, urg (urgent), ack (acknowledgement), psh (push), rst
(reset), syn (synchronize) and fin (finish).
udp Specifies that the switch will examine each frame’s
Universal Datagram Protocol (UDP) field.
src_port_mask <hex 0x0-0xffff> Specifies a UDP port
mask for the source port.
dst_port_mask <hex 0x0-0xffff> Specifies a UDP port
mask for the destination port.
protocol_id Specifies that the switch will examine each
frame’s Protocol ID field.
user_define_mask <hex 0x0-0xffffffff> Specifies that the
rule applies to the IP protocol ID and the mask options
behind the IP header.
packet_content_mask – Specifies that the switch will mask
the packet header beginning with the offset value specified
as follows:
offset_0-15 – Enter a value in hex form to mask the
packet from the beginning of the packet to the 16
th
byte.
offset_16-31 - Enter a value in hex form to mask the
packet from byte 16 to byte 31.
offset_32-47 - Enter a value in hex form to mask the
packet from byte 32 to byte 47.
offset_48-63 - Enter a value in hex form to mask the
packet from byte 48 to byte 63.
offset_64-79 - Enter a value in hex form to mask the
packet from byte 64 to byte 79.
